tolerable in Finnish is siedettävä, välttävä — tolerable means able to be endured or put up with; bearable.
tolerable in Finnish
siedettävä
Capable of being borne, tolerated or endured; bearable or endurable.
välttävä
What does "tolerable" mean?
-
adjective Able to be endured or put up with; bearable.
"The heat was tolerable as long as we stayed in the shade."
-
adjective Acceptable but not impressive; passable or mediocre.
"The food at the new café was tolerable, nothing more."
